About

Bernd Steinbach is a scholar working on Computational Theory and Mathematics, Artificial Intelligence and Electrical and Electronic Engineering. According to data from OpenAlex, Bernd Steinbach has authored 55 papers receiving a total of 351 ind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Computational Theory and Mathematics, 15 papers in Artificial Intelligence and 12 papers in Electrical and Electronic Engineering. Recurrent topics in Bernd Steinbach's work include Formal Methods in Verification (13 papers), Advanced Graph Theory Research (8 papers) and Constraint Satisfaction and Optimization (6 papers). Bernd Steinbach is often cited by papers focused on Formal Methods in Verification (13 papers), Advanced Graph Theory Research (8 papers) and Constraint Satisfaction and Optimization (6 papers). Bernd Steinbach collaborates with scholars based in Germany, Trinidad and Tobago and Jamaica. Bernd Steinbach's co-authors include Christian Posthoff, Alan Mishchenko, Marek Perkowski, Christian A. Lang, F. Schümann, Chunhui Wu, Alexis De Vos, Karin Steinbach, Zhiwei Sun and Dominik Fröhlich and has published in prestigious journals such as Artificial Intelligence Review, The Journal of Technology Transfer and Journal of Computational and Theoretical Nanoscience.
